Definitions
- through; adverbial form of caurs
-
through, from one side to the other (crossing places, space, etc.) with-dative
-
through (despite, unhindered by, not kept in place by) with-dative
- through (entirely; without interruption; through all relevant objects)
- finished, done, through, over
Examples
“iziet cauri priekšnamam”
to exit through the hallway
“viņi jau bija mežam cauri”
they had already been through the forest
“rakties aizsprostam cauri”
to dig through the dam
“izdurt papīram cauri”
to pierce a hole through the paper
“stikls tik netīrs, ka neredz cauri”
the glass is so dirty that one can't see through (it)
“cauri aizkariem spiežas gaisma”
the light shines through the curtains
“jumtam cauri sūcas ūdens”
water is seeping through the roof
“trauksmes signāls skan cauri vētrai”
the alarm signal sounds through the storm
“kliedzieni dzirdami troksnim cauri”
shots heard through the noise
“laist cauri”
to let (something) through, not stop it
“vairākkārt lasīt cauri”
to read it through several times
“sniga visu nakti cauri”
it snowed all night long, the whole night through
“strādāt visu dienu cauri”
to work all day long, the whole day through
“skatīt cauri iesniegtos dokumentus”
to read through (all) the submitted documents
“brīvdienas jau cauri”
the holidays are already over
“šis darbs nu ir cauri”
this work is now over
“lasīt, kamēr grāmata cauri”
to read until the book is finished
